Key concepts and overview
Australian casino banking methods encompass a range of options that players can utilize to deposit and withdraw funds. These methods include credit and debit cards, e-wallets, bank transfers, and prepaid cards. Each method varies in terms of processing speed, convenience, and security features. Main features and details
When examining the main features of Australian casino banking methods, several key components emerge:
- Processing Speed: This refers to how quickly transactions are completed. E-wallets typically offer instant transactions, while bank transfers may take several days.
- Convenience: The ease of use of a banking method can significantly influence player preferences. Methods that require minimal steps and provide user-friendly interfaces are often favored.
- Security: Players prioritize the safety of their financial information. Methods that offer encryption and fraud protection are more likely to be trusted.
- Fees: Transaction fees can vary widely among different banking methods. Players often seek methods that minimize costs associated with deposits and withdrawals.
Practical examples and use cases
To illustrate the practical applications of these banking methods, consider the following scenarios:
- Credit and Debit Cards: A player using a Visa card can deposit funds instantly into their casino account, allowing for immediate gameplay. However, withdrawals may take longer, often requiring additional verification steps.
- E-Wallets: Players opting for PayPal or Skrill benefit from quick deposits and withdrawals, often completed within hours. This method is particularly popular among players who value speed.
- Bank Transfers: While this method is secure, it is less convenient due to longer processing times. A player may choose this method for larger withdrawals, accepting the wait for enhanced security.
- Prepaid Cards: These cards allow players to deposit funds without linking to a bank account, offering a layer of anonymity. However, they may not be suitable for withdrawals, limiting their overall utility.
Advantages and disadvantages
Each banking method presents its own set of advantages and disadvantages:
- Credit and Debit Cards:
- Advantages: Widely accepted, instant deposits.
- Disadvantages: Longer withdrawal times, potential for declined transactions.
- E-Wallets:
- Advantages: Fast transactions, enhanced security features.
- Disadvantages: Some casinos may not accept all e-wallets, potential fees for transactions.
- Bank Transfers:
- Advantages: High security, suitable for large transactions.
- Disadvantages: Slow processing times, not ideal for immediate access to funds.
- Prepaid Cards:
- Advantages: Anonymity, no need for a bank account.
- Disadvantages: Limited use for withdrawals, potential fees for card purchase.
